The Little Pack Donkey
by Kathryn and Bryon Jackson
2
Once there was a sad little donkey. "It's no use," he said to himself. "I try to be as good as a horse. But I just can't be. A horse can go racing around a herd of cattle. He can do it with a cowboy on his back. And I just can't do that."
The donkey drooped his long ears.
3
"The horses laugh at me," he cried. "They say my ears are too long. And they say my legs are too short. Why, they even say that I'm only good for eating grass!" And he sadly ate some grass.
Just then some cowboys came riding by. They were going to a high pass up in the mountains. And they were taking lots of things with them. They were taking food. They were taking pots and pans. And they were taking bedrolls and warm clothes.
4
All these things made a big pack. And the horses just couldn't carry such a big pack--at least not up a steep mountain. Oh, no! Horses would slip and fall.
So the cowboys took all their things off the horses. They put them on the little donkey's back. Then they got on their horses and rode up the mountain path.
The horses couldn't go fast. They kept sliding and slipping. But the little donkey could go fast. He didn't slide or slip. He could go fast even with the big pack on his back.
5
"I don't know what we'd do without that little donkey," said a cowboy named Pete.
"No, sir," said the other cowboys. "There's nothing like a donkey for uphill work."
And the horses said, "He sure can climb with those short little legs!"
The donkey waggled his long ears. Now he felt much better. Now he liked being a little donkey.
"Maybe I'm some use after all," he said to himself. And he trotted quickly up the mountain.
